Allagash Curieux 10.2%
Curieux is an aged Tripel, a Belgian-style golden ale, in bourbon barrels for approximately seven weeks. After that time is up, the barrel-aged beer with is blended with a portion of fresh Tripel, to layer the beer with its signature notes of vanilla, caramel, oak, and hint of bourbon.

Allagash White 5.2%
award-winning interpretation of a Belgian-style wheat beer is brewed with oats, malted wheat, and raw wheat for a hazy “white” appearance. Spiced with our own special blend of coriander and Curaçao orange peel, Allagash White upholds the Belgian tradition of beers that are both complex and refreshing.

Duvel Belgium 8.5%
Rated 98/100. Duvel is a natural beer with a subtle bitterness, a refined flavor and a distinctive hop character. The refermentation in the bottle and a long maturation, guarantees a pure character, delicate effervescence and a pleasant sweet taste of alcohol.

Beer is the third most popular beverage in the world, coming in behind tea and water.
Monks brewing beer in the Middle Ages were allowed to drink five pints of beer a day.
The oldest known recipe is for beer.

One of the reason the Pilgrims landed at Plymouth Rock in 1620, rather than sail further south to a warmer climate, was because their supplies were dwindling, “especially our beer.”
